Marie-Auguste de Balsac (born in 1788) was a senior official and French politician of the beginning of the 19th century of origin aveyronnaise, which was successively secretary-general of the Ministry for the Interior, Préfet, to advise State, Député, General adviser. Invested title of baron by ordinance of the November 21st 1822, he will be commander of the Légion of honor in 1827. Married to Blanche of Couronnel in 1822.

Family

Marie-Auguste de Balsac was the son of lord Marc-Antoine de Balsac, knight of Firmi, lord of Colombiès to the diocese of Rodez, Capitaine with the regiment of Vexin and knight of Saint-Louis, and Victoire de Barrau.

Political mandates

  • President of the large-college of the the Moselle in 1829, and its deputy

  • President of the electoral college of Villefranche (Aveyron) in 1830
  • Elected several times Appointed of Aveyron
  • Member of the General advice of Aveyron in 1848

Other functions

  • Member of the general advice of the prisons of the kingdom in 1829

  • In 1830, he is vice-president of the charitable establishments

Titles of nobility

  • It is invested title of baron by ordinance of November 21st, 1822

Decorations

  • It is made commander of the Légion of Honor on December 12th, 1827
